SONUS NETWORKS ESTABLISHES OEM RELATIONSHIP WITH MOTOROLA TO INTEGRATE THE GSX9000 MEDIA GATEWAY WITH THE MOTOROLA SOFTSWITCH FOR WIRELESS NETWORKS
Sonus Media Gateway Chosen by Motorola for Wireless Operator Customers Worldwide
CHELMSFORD, Mass., February 24, 2004 – Sonus Networks (Nasdaq: SONS), a leading provider of carrier packet voice infrastructure solutions, today announced that Motorola Inc. and Sonus have established an original equipment manufacturer (OEM) relationship through which Motorola has integrated Sonus’ industry-leading GSX9000 media gateway with the Motorola SoftSwitch (MSS), a next-generation switching platform for wireless carriers around the globe.

“The GSX9000 combines advanced DSP technology and mature, fully featured software, making it particularly well suited for deployment with major service providers worldwide. A single GSX9000 chassis can support up to 22,176 simultaneous VoIP calls and up to 28,224 DS0s. The NEBS-compliant GSX9000 provides fully redundant configurations that are designed for 99.999% availability.

About Sonus Networks
“Sonus Networks, Inc. is a leading provider of packet voice infrastructure solutions for wireline and wireless service providers. With its Open Services Architecture (OSA), Sonus delivers end-to-end solutions addressing a full range of carrier applications, including trunking, residential access and Centrex, tandem switching, and IP voice termination, as well as enhanced services. Sonus’ award-winning voice infrastructure solutions, including media gateways, softswitches and network management systems, are deployed in service provider networks worldwide. Sonus, founded in 1997, is headquartered in Chelmsford, Massachusetts. Additional information on Sonus is available at http://www.sonusnet.com.
